export function createUuid(): string {
const cryptoApi = globalThis.crypto;
if (typeof cryptoApi?.randomUUID === "function") {
return cryptoApi.randomUUID();
}
const bytes = new Uint8Array(16);
if (typeof cryptoApi?.getRandomValues === "function") {
cryptoApi.getRandomValues(bytes);
} else {
for (let index = 0; index < bytes.length; index += 1) {
bytes[index] = Math.floor(Math.random() * 256);
}
}
bytes[6] = ((bytes[6] ?? 0) & 0x0f) | 0x40;
bytes[8] = ((bytes[8] ?? 0) & 0x3f) | 0x80;
const hex = Array.from(bytes, (value) =>
value.toString(16).padStart(2, "0"),
).join("");
return [
hex.slice(0, 8),
hex.slice(8, 12),
hex.slice(12, 16),
hex.slice(16, 20),
hex.slice(20),
].join("-");
}

// API client for the platform backend.
//
// All endpoints that take a workspace context require the caller to
// pass `workspaceId` explicitly. Components read the active workspace
// from `useAuth().currentWorkspace` and thread it through; the cookie
// set by `/api/v1/auth/login` is sent automatically thanks to
// `credentials: "same-origin"`, and the backend reads it via the
// shared `request_context` dependency.
//
// 401 from any endpoint means the session has expired or was never
// established; the global `apiRequest` helper bounces the user to
// `/login` so the platform never tries to render with a stale identity.
